Understanding the Email’s Significance

The primary goal of an email requesting a site visit is to formally invite someone to your facility. It’s the first impression in some cases. The email needs to be professional, polite, and informative. It should clearly state the purpose of the visit, the date and time, and any necessary instructions or information.

Here’s why getting it right matters:

  • Professionalism: A well-written email reflects positively on your company.
  • Clarity: Avoids confusion and ensures the visitor knows what to expect.
  • Efficiency: Reduces back-and-forth communication and saves time.

The email should include essential details to guide your visitor. Think of it as a roadmap.

  1. Purpose of Visit: Clearly state why you’re inviting them.
  2. Date and Time: Provide specific details.
  3. Location and Directions: How to find your facility.

Email for a Job Interview Invitation

Subject: Job Interview Invitation – [Your Company Name] – [Job Title]

Dear [Candidate Name],

Thank you for your interest in the [Job Title] position at [Your Company Name]. We were impressed with your application and resume, and we would like to invite you for an interview.

We have scheduled your interview for [Date] at [Time] at our facility located at:

[Your Company Address]

Please arrive [Number] minutes prior to your scheduled interview time to allow for check-in. The interview will be conducted by [Interviewer Name] and will last approximately [Duration].

During the interview, you can expect to [Briefly describe the interview process, e.g., discuss your experience, answer questions about the role, etc.]. Please bring a copy of your resume and any other relevant documents you’d like to share.

If these times are not suitable for you, or if you have any questions, please contact us at [Phone Number] or reply to this email.

We look forward to meeting you.

Sincerely,

[Your Name/HR Department]

Email for a Client Meeting Request

Subject: Site Visit Invitation – [Your Company Name] – [Project Name/Topic]

Dear [Client Name],

We hope this email finds you well.

We would like to invite you to our facility to discuss [Project Name/Topic] in more detail and provide you with an overview of our capabilities. We believe a site visit would provide you a better understanding of our operations and expertise.

We propose a meeting on [Date] at [Time]. The meeting will take place at:

[Your Company Address]

We will also provide a tour of our facilities to showcase [Highlight specific areas relevant to the client, e.g., our manufacturing processes, our research labs, etc.].

The agenda would include [Briefly list agenda items, e.g., a presentation, a Q&A session, a facility tour].

Please let us know if this time works for you or if you would prefer an alternative date or time. We are flexible and happy to accommodate your schedule.

We look forward to your visit and the opportunity to collaborate further.

Sincerely,

[Your Name/Your Title]

Tips for a great Site Visit Email

  • Keep it concise: Get straight to the point.
  • Be specific: Provide clear details about the visit.
  • Proofread carefully: Check for any errors.
  • Include contact information: Make it easy for the recipient to reach you.
  • Follow up: Send a reminder before the visit.
